Matchstick Shades
Matchstick shades are also known as bamboo shades or woven wood shades. They offer an elegant South Pacific or tropical feel to a room, apartment or guesthouse. Generally, each woven wood shade will be slightly different in appearance as the unique characteristics from each piece of wood will be slightly different.

SlumberShades
Some of us have a good night's sleep every night, but others of us struggle with light sensitivity from street lamps, or the inability to sleep during the day. Those with night jobs often struggle to get 8 - 10 hours of sleep, the recommended amount of time needed for a good night's sleep, as their bodies are telling them they should be awake with the sun. New shades have hit the market to help resolve this problem. They are called SlumberShades and they block light from windows, using an innovative sidetrack system. According to the National Sleep Foundation, the best night's sleep comes from a dark, quiet, comfortable atmosphere.

Cordless Blinds Save Children’s Lives
Every year children die or are injured from dangling cords attached to window treatments, blinds and shades. The threat comes from kids or pets playing near window treatments where they can become entangled in the cord. While organizations are set up to help educate parents about this issue, we don't think there can be enough information about children's safety.
